28 /* this program is used to test the locking of a recursive mutex in a static C++ constructor
29  * this operation crashes on some
30  */
31 #include <pthread.h>
32 #include <stdio.h>
33 
34 class Foo {
35 private:
36     pthread_mutex_t  mMutex;
37 public:
38     virtual int   getValue();
39     Foo();
40     virtual ~Foo();
41 };
42 
Foo()43 Foo::Foo()
44 {
45     pthread_mutexattr_t  mattr;
46 
47     pthread_mutexattr_init(&mattr);
48     pthread_mutexattr_settype(&mattr, PTHREAD_MUTEX_RECURSIVE);
49     pthread_mutex_init(&mMutex, &mattr);
50     pthread_mutex_lock(&mMutex);
51     fprintf(stderr, "recursive lock initialized and locked\n" );
52 }
53 
~Foo()54 Foo::~Foo()
55 {
56     pthread_mutex_unlock(&mMutex);
57 }
58 
getValue()59 int Foo::getValue()
60 {
61     return 0;
62 }
63 
64 static Foo  f;
65 
main(void)66 int main(void)
67 {
68     printf( "f.getValue() returned: %d\n", f.getValue() );
69     return 0;
70 }
